SLICKLINE MEMORY LOGGING TOOL
The Mini Logging Tool (MLT) is a compact version of a production logging tool. Designed
with four sensors, the MLT can provide correlated data on pressure, temperature, depth and
flow rates.
The MLT is designed to be a modular tool. The 3 main modules are the platinum Resistant
Temperature Detector (RTD) module, the Casing Collar Locator (CCL), and the Pressure/Flow
module.
The Platinum RTD provides a fast and high resolution temperature profile along the wellbore.
The RTD module uses dual Platinum RTD's to measure temperature. Using dual RTD’s
increases the sensitivity of the module, and negates the chances of the RTD being shielded by
the MLT not being centred within the tubing string.
The electromagnetic CCL measures depth by measuring the change in electromagnetic field
that occurs at each casing, or tubing collar. Since the length of each joint is known, tool depth
can be inferred from this depth, and correlated with the rest of the data. The Pressure/Flow
module is economical in design. The external housing is universal. Different calibrated
modules are then inserted into the external housing, depending on what pressure range the tool
will be encountering.
The MLT also uses a replaceable memory module. The memory module us connected to the top
module within the string. Modules can be interchanged, allowing for the module to be changed
out, and a second survey to be done with a new module, while the first module is downloaded.
Any combination of modules can be used at one time. The only restraint is that only 1
Pressure/Flow module can be used at once, and it must be run at the bottom of the string.

Bottom Hole Sampling
TCI provides for bottom hole sampling to taking of representative reservoir fluid
samples. The sampler can also be operated to take Single Phase Samples (SPS)
from which samples are maintained at a pressure above the reservoir pressure,
back to the PVT laboratory. Samples, when analyzed, provide data vital for the
economic and technical evaluation of the reservoir.
The sampler is run on wire line (slick or electric) and can be triggered by a
mechanical firing device or surface firing via an electric line. Multiple samplers
can also be run simultaneously.
For transportation of samples, a range of cylinders (700 ml) can be supplied
with pressure ratings of 5,000, 10,000 and 15,000 psi. For the USA market,
DOT-approved cylinders are also available.
OPERATION PARAMETERS:
The material of construction of the sampling tool and transportation cylinders is
NACE (National Association of Corrosion Engineers) approved for
"SOUR GAS" service.
Sample Volume : 600 ml, Max. Working Pressure : 15,000 psi at 180°C (356°F)
Length : PDS: 12' 1" (3,680 mm), SPS: 16' 7" (5,054 mm)
Weight : PDS: 61.6 lb (28 kg), SPS: 74.8 lb (34kg),
Outside Diameter : 1-11/16 " (43 mm)

BOTTOM HOLE SAMPLING
Description:
P.D.S. S.P.S. MK II, Sampling tool is a device for taking in-situ reservoir
samples. The purpose of the is to provide a high quality representative
sample which is maintained in single phase (using nitrogen gas).
Subsequent PVT analysis of sample can provide data for economic and
technical evaluation of a reservoir. The tool has been designed to operate
in most environments and consistently produce representative samples
regardless of the or conditions. Transportation box available.
Volume:
600 ml Sample, 450 ml Nitrogen
M.A.W.P: 1035 Bar g @ 180 Deg C, (15,000 psi @ 356 Deg F)
Material: 17-4 PH STSTL (AISI 630), Aluminium Bronze CA104. All
conform to N.A.C.E. MRO 175 latest review.
Net weight: 34 kg (75 lb) Dimensions: Diameter: 1 11/16”(43 mm)
Length: 16’ 7” (5054 mm)

Well Deliverability
Well Deliverability:
Accurate forecasting of Gas Production
requires integrating reservoir volumes
(reserve), Sand Face and Wellhead
Deliverability, Well Bore Hydraulic,
Pipeline and compression capacity and
other factors such as sales contracts.
This is achieved by the understanding
the inter-relationship between Reserves,
Deliverability and Gas Gathering
Systems.
